Why Do People Tell White Lies?

Understanding the psychology behind why people tell white lies can be just as entertaining as the lies themselves. Here are some reasons:

  • To protect someone's feelings: Nobody wants to hurt a friend with harsh truths.
  • To avoid conflict: Sometimes, it’s easier to say "yes" than to explain why not.
  • To make oneself look better: Who doesn’t want to appear more interesting or successful?
  • To be polite: A little white lie can smooth over awkward social situations.

Can White Lies Be Harmful?

While most white lies are innocent, there are instances where they can lead to complications. Here’s how:

  • Trust issues: If someone discovers a white lie, it may lead to a loss of trust.
  • Misunderstandings: Sometimes, a white lie can spiral into a bigger issue.
  • Guilt: Some people may feel guilty about not being completely honest.

How Do We Spot a White Lie?

Identifying a white lie can sometimes be tricky. Here are some signs to look out for:

  • Inconsistencies in the story: If details don’t match up, it might be a lie.
  • Excessive enthusiasm: If someone is overly excited about a straightforward question, it could be a sign.
  • Body language: Fidgeting or avoiding eye contact can indicate dishonesty.
